Termites are among numerous bugs that can do harm to the structure of your house or home. Each year, billions of dollars in property damage is assessed and represented by these bugs. Termites damage wood and various cellulose materials. In extreme scenarios, they can eventually tunnel through the entire wooden framework of your house, making it unsafe to inhabit.

How do you detect a termite infestation?

You might observe a swarm of flying termites looking for a place to nest in the spring. You might see mud tubes near your structure. You might see soft, discolored, blistering wood. Or, you may not see anything. It often takes a expert to detect a termite infestation. That is why law needs termite examinations as part of the house purchasing process.

Indications of Termite Infestations.

The most common types of termite in the Exeter location is the Subterranean termite. Since this species builds tunnels into your home, a colony is able to trigger substantial termite damage before the infestation is ever discovered. One of the most apparent indications of a termite issue is the existence of "mud tunnels". These tunnels are produced on the outside of your home's support and facilities to keep the termites moist while moving from one location to another. More noticeable signs of damage include:

  • Damage to wood.
  • Sagging/buckling floors.
  • Swollen floorings or ceilings.
  • Exploratory tubes.

We offer multiple termite treatment options in Exeter New Hampshire

Traditional Liquid Applications: Some infestations need a more aggressive technique. Our group has the ability to perform sub-soil liquid applications by trenching & rodding soil along foundations, drilling & injection of on-slab structures, and drilling & injecting hollow block structures.

Wood Treatment & Void Applications: when termites in Exeter are aggressively attacking the wooden members of your structure, We can use drilling & injection of foam inside wall voids as well as harmed lumbers. We likewise provides exposed wood applications utilizing a Bora-Care service to further protect your house.

Termite Baiting Systems (TBS): The finest way to keep an eye on and to control the whole termite colony is with the setup of the Advance Termite Baiting System. This procedure can take more time to be reliable, however there is no risk to your household or the environment.
